When a guarded single mom meets a famous musician hiding from the spotlight, this Christmas becomes a season of second chances, soft smiles, and a love song only their hearts can hear.

Hailie Bennett has her life under control, or at least, that’s what she tells herself. As Laurel Springs’s event planner and a widowed mom of two, she’s mastered the art of staying busy, staying structured, and keeping her heart safely locked away. Dating? Not on her carefully color-coded calendar.

But when a last-minute cancellation leaves the town’s annual Christmas concert without a headliner, enter Levi Raines, the country music star who walked away from sold-out tours and stadium lights to find himself again in a quiet town where he can finally breathe.

Levi didn’t come to Laurel Springs looking for love. He came for silence, space to write, and a chance to exist without the weight of fame crushing his creativity. But the woman who insists on doing everything herself, who’s built walls so high even she can’t see past them? She pulls him in without trying.

Her strength is magnetic. Her vulnerability, sacred. And her kids? They’ve already claimed his heart.

As rehearsals turn into shared coffees and mistletoe moments grow harder to avoid, Hailie feels her carefully constructed world shifting. Levi makes her laugh. He makes her hope. He makes her want again. Something she thought she’d buried for good. But letting him in means risking everything she’s rebuilt. What if his sabbatical ends? What if the life he left behind comes calling? And what if she’s brave enough to love him anyway?
